Blocked Drains in Thirty Year Old Homes
Drains built into Ridgewood homes at construction have carried a full family load for three decades, and that catches up with them. Cooking fat, shampoo residue, wet wipes and garden grit gather along the pipe walls until a basin empties slowly or a floor waste starts to bubble. A patch of damp lawn tracking over the line is another tell worth acting on early.
We push a drain camera through the pipe to pin the exact blockage, clear it with high pressure water, then advise whether a spot repair or a full reline will keep it running. On estates of this vintage the early PVC joints can shift as the sandy ground settles beneath them. Our blocked drains service restores flow and fixes the cause.

Worn Builder Grade Tapware
The tapware a project builder fitted through Ridgewood in the 1990s was chosen to be affordable, not to last forever, and it now shows. Ceramic discs, rubber washers and spindles that have turned thousands of times give out, leaving a drip that no amount of tightening will settle. Green staining in the basin and a creeping meter reading tend to follow close behind.
We repair and swap out taps of every type, from the basic builder fittings still common here to sealed mixers, and can match new tapware across a bathroom when a full update makes sense. The garden and laundry taps get the same attention. Our leaking tap repairs end the drip properly and pull the wasted litres back off your bill.

Gas Leaks and Gas Fitting
Gas faults call for immediate action. A sulphur smell near an appliance, a soft hissing along a line, or a cooktop flame that will not hold all mean a licensed gas plumber needs to attend without delay. Gas runs installed when the estate went up tend to weaken at aged unions and fittings, and even a minor indoor escape endangers a full household.
We trace and seal gas leaks, service gas appliances, and complete safe gas fitting for cooktops, room heaters and hot water units, pressure testing the whole run before we pack up. If you suspect a gas leak, shut the supply at the meter when it is safe, open the windows wide, keep clear of switches and flames, and phone us at once.
Leak Detection on Sandy Ground
Plenty of leaks never surface on their own. A bill that climbs for no clear reason, a stain creeping across a ceiling, the hum of water with every tap shut, or a meter that will not settle all point to water slipping away unseen. Ridgewood’s loose sandy soil lets an underground leak wash away for months before a wet spot ever appears.
We use sound and thermal imaging equipment to fix the exact location beneath slabs, inside cavities and under paving without tearing the home apart. Slab leaks and split retic mains turn up often on ground like this. Our leak detection hands you a clear diagnosis and a plan before anyone lifts a shovel, so the repair stays contained.

Reticulation and Garden Watering
Almost every Ridgewood block waters a reticulated garden, and the free draining sandy ground keeps our outdoor work steady. A split poly line, a solenoid stuck open, a controller that will not cycle and perished garden taps all bleed water and drive the summer bill up, right when the lawns and garden beds need every drop they can get.
We locate the fault, mend the line and check the backflow device and outside tapware while we are on site. A retic system sealed and cycling correctly saves a striking amount of water on soil that drains as fast as this.
